/* Make the image fully responsive */

#spandropdown{
    margin-left:5px;
}
  #hr{
 
    display: block;
    height: 1px;
    border: 0;
    border-top: 1px solid black;
    margin: 1em 0;
    padding: 0; 

  }
  .carousel-inner img {
      width:100%;
      height:500px;
  }
      .view-group {
    display: -ms-flexbox;
    display: flex;
    -ms-flex-direction: row;
    flex-direction: row;
    padding-left: 0;
    margin-bottom: 0;
}
.thumbnail
{
    margin-bottom: 30px;
    padding: 0px;
    -webkit-border-radius: 0px;
    -moz-border-radius: 0px;
    border-radius: 0px;
}

.item.list-group-item
{
    float: none;
    width: 100%;
    background-color: #fff;
    margin-bottom: 30px;
    -ms-flex: 0 0 100%;
    flex: 0 0 100%;
    max-width: 100%;
    padding: 0 1rem;
    border: 0;
}
.item.list-group-item .img-event {
    float: left;
    width: 30%;
}

.item.list-group-item .list-group-image
{
    margin-right: 10px;
}
.item.list-group-item .thumbnail
{
    margin-bottom: 0px;
    display: inline-block;
}
.item.list-group-item .caption
{
    float: left;
    width: 70%;
    margin: 0;
}

.item.list-group-item:before, .item.list-group-item:after
{
    display: table;
    content: " ";
}

.item.list-group-item:after
{
    clear: both;
}
#idno1{
    background-color: #EDEDED  ;
}
#discount{
color:#FF3535;
}
.tablefotter{
border-top:1px solid black;
border-bottom:1px solid black;
margin-top: 10px; 
margin-bottom: 2px;
width: 100%;
}
.centerfooter{
margin-top:10px;
margin-bottom:10px;
}
#imgfooter{
width: 18px;
margin-bottom:3px; 
margin-right:2px;
}
.inputfooter{
width: 100%;
background-color: #EDEDED;
border: none;
}
.spanfooter{
text-decoration: none;
color: black ;
}
.h4footer{
    margin-top:6px;
}
.table1footer{
width:100%;
border-top:1px solid black; 
}
.tableimg{
width:100%;
height:380px;
margin-bottom:10px;
}
.carrerdiv{
background-color: #efefefef;
     
 
}
.carrerh1{
     font-style: oblique;
    text-align: center;

}
.carrerhr{
    display: block;
    height: 1px;
    border: 0;
    border-top: 1px solid #ecececec;
    margin: 1em 0;
    padding: 0; 
}
.carrerpara{
    font-size:19px;
    line-height:10px;
     font-style: oblique;
}
.carrerimg{
    margin-bottom:20px;
    margin-top:20px;
    width: 100%;
}
.para1{
    line-height:40px;
}
.para2{
    line-height:20px;
}
.para3{
    line-height:30px;
}
#carrerspan{
    font-style: oblique;
     font-weight: lighter;
}
#spancarrerpara{
font-style:oblique; 
font-weight: lighter;

}
.carrerpara123{
    margin-bottom: 10px;
}
.buutonstore{
    background-color: black;
    color: white;
    width:200px;
    height:35px;
    border:none;
}
#exchangediv{
    font-size:15px;
}
#comparepid{
    background-color: #efefefef;
}
